Episode description

LLN (5/7/20) – OOIDA has fought for many years for greater transparency between brokers and motor carriers, and the pandemic has highlighted why the lack of it is a problem. Also, the FMCSA has expanded a program designed to help truckers if they have a no-fault collision on their records, while a new app to help truckers in disasters is released. And Colorado’s governor has signed bills addressing some highway speed limits and fees for overweight permits; meanwhile, variable speed limits are proposed for some South Dakota roads.
